NPF on Nagaland Deputy Chief Minister
Kohima, 26th November 2018
The Naga People's Front is constraint to issue this press release regarding the much controversial talk between the Nagaland Deputy Chief Minister and in-charge of Home, Y Patton and State Chief Secretary, R. Benchilo Thong (IAS) on the subject matter of transferring case of Additional Director General of Police (DGP), Rupin Sharma.
The NPF expressed shocked and bewilderment at the manner in which the Deputy CM has threatened the state executive head, Mr. Thong over the latest row regarding Mr. Sharma's transferring case.
The ADGP, Mr. Sharma who was removed as DGP, a couple of months back is seeking for a deputation to Nagaland House, New Delhi and his file, which is under process has once again under the scanner as the Deputy CM is seen verbally threatening the Chief Secretary using derogatory languages to the highest bureaucracy of the state.
It has come to light with enough documentation proof that Mr. Rupin Sharma has requested for posting at New Delhi attached to Nagaland House, for his medical check-up and to pursue his deputation. But unfortunately, the Home Commissioner has moved the file for grant of medical leaves which Mr. Sharma has not prayed for , and hence the matter was brought to the notice of the Chief Minister of Nagaland , Neiphiu Rio, whereby taking exception to the genuine request put up by Mr. Sharma , the CM has agreed to place him at Nagaland House , and hence , necessary directives were given by CMO to the Home Commissioner for putting up the file to Hon'ble CM.
What followed thereafter has shocked the people of the state like a bolt from the blue, as according to sources, the Deputy CM, Mr. Patton has gone to the extent of threatening to finish off the Chief Secretary, Mr. Thong after his return from Mizoram.
The question that NPF has put acrossed to all Nagas is, " How far are we going to bear these brunts and the unruly behaviorial attitudes of our today's political leaders? When the top Bureaucrats in the state can be threatened and dragged like dirt in the streets, how safe are the other public servants from the hands of these brute's?", asked the NPF.
It can be assumed that the Chief Secretary has become a sandwiched between the Chief Minister and the Deputy CM due to their clash of interest and not for the welfare of the state. The NPF is also amused over the silent of the PDA Chief Minister over the recent drama and asked the Chief Minster to come out with clarity as no officers should suffer at their behest.
Further, the PDA Government, which is marred by one controversy after another depicting its deep insecurity within their ruling partners should not disgrace the law of the land but to immediately look
upon the book of the law of the land and enforce it.
